... All the outputs are high unless G1 is high and G2 is low. The 54HC137 is ideally suited for the implementation of glitch-free decoders application in bus oriented systems. All inputs are equipped with protection circuits against static discharge and transient excess voltage. FPC-16 EM M54HC137D1 M54HC137K1 in stored-address 1/10 ...
